    Westbury Facts – Did you know…

    1. Two Princess
      Both Prince William and Prince Harry passed their officer training in the town. Tests included an assault course, planning exercises and a physical which required 44 press-ups in two minutes. Phew!
    2. Battle of Edington
      Just outside the town sits the site of one of the most pivotal battles in English history where Alfred the Great defeated the Vikings, saving the Kingdom of Wessex and building a future England.
    3. West Borough
      The town’s name derives from the fact it stood to the west of Trowbridge. ‘Bury’ comes from burgh, a form of defended settlement, the same derivation as the German burg in cities like Hamburg.
    4. White Horse
      Westbury’s famous white horse has been attracting visitors to the town since the 18th century. Visible from miles around, it stands close to the perimeter of Salisbury Plains.
    5. Vote Westbury!
      In 1868 two businessmen and landowners Abraham Laverton and JL Phipps competed to become local MP. Phipps was accused of intimidating his workers and tenants into voting for him. The vote was overturned starting a long-running feud.
    6. Bad Blood
      After John Phipps’ death, his brother erected a monument to him in Market Square and continued the spat. Laverton’s name can still be seen throughout the town.

    About

    Once an important market town with a cloth and glove industry, Westbury held borough status and at one point had two MPs. It has played a vital role in England’s history, providing pivotal moments for British (and indeed world) politics and also a turning point in the very formation in the creation of England as a country.

    Today a quiet town, it doesn’t have the biggest range of shops but it does have a busy and noisy events calendar including colourful music festivals and Christmas traditions.

    Leisure

    Westbury has one of the country’s oldest swimming pools, there is also a leisure centre and a number of good restaurants. Shopaholics won’t find too much to get their plastic out for, but Warminster and Trowbridge both offer a wider selection of shops.

    Westbury has a number of festivals including a vintage car show, summer festival, Christmas festival (both held in the market square), there is also the Westbury Festival with live music and performance, plus the Village Pump Festival that has hosted names like The Proclaimers, Bellowhead and Fishermen’s Friends.

    Bratton Camp overlooking the white horse was the site of an Iron Age fort and today is a Site of Special Scientific Interest.
